A recap on differences between amaranth and clementine
- Amaranth has more manganese, iron, phosphorus, magnesium, copper, selenium, and zinc; however, clementine is higher in vitamin B1.
- Amaranth covers your daily manganese needs 36% more than clementine.
- Clementine contains 55 times less selenium than amaranth. Amaranth contains 5.5µg of selenium, while clementine contains 0.1µg.
- The glycemic index of amaranth is higher.
Food varieties used in this article are Amaranth grain, cooked and Clementines, raw.
